Since writing this letter Jan has received the following reply from CalMac

Dear Ms Herbert, In the first instance let me assure you that CalMac takes its responsibi­lity for handling the COVID-19 outbreak very seriously.

We have a full COVID-19 response team in place which meets every day, and which has been working to ensure our customers and staff are already responding to the latest government instructio­ns surroundin­g the current outbreak. We work closely and frequently with Transport Scotland, the Scottish government’s resilience team and Health Protection Scotland to stay on top of the latest advice and guidance from government and health officials.

In terms of the wiping situation, we are looking into what happened to see if our policies were followed. We have a new rigorous regime in place which means that all ‘high touch’ surfaces are wiped using specialist cleaning equipment every two hours on the vessels. There may not be a visual spray being used but the cloths are treated with specialist antibacter­ial cleaning materials that make them suitable for all food-related surfaces such as tables and trays.

In terms of travelling on the car deck, our hands are tied by existing legislatio­n. The only circumstan­ces in which we could take your husband to the mainland and back on the car deck would be if he were in an ambulance. Allowing passengers to remain in their vehicles is a matter that resides with the Maritime and Coastguard Agency (MCA). At this time, CalMac does not have the authority to allow passengers to remain in their vehicles on our major vessels unless expressly authorised by the MCA. We will work closely alongside the MCA and we will keep you posted of any future developmen­ts they make in this area.

I hope I have reassured you around our cleaning regime and apologise that there is nothing we can do in relation to hospital visits. I would suggest you make contact with the NHS to see if there is anything further they can offer you in terms of ambulatory treatment or any other arrangemen­ts.

Yours,

Robert Morrison, Operations Director, Calmac Ferries Ltd.
